The square tube machine has emerged as a cornerstone in the field of metal tube manufacturing. It represents a remarkable fusion of engineering and technology to produce high - quality square tubes.
At the heart of the square tube machine's functionality is its ability to precisely form metal. The process commences with the selection of suitable raw materials, often metal sheets of specific thicknesses and grades. These are fed into the machine's entry point. The machine then utilizes a series of rollers and shaping tools. The rollers work in tandem to gradually manipulate the metal, applying consistent pressure to form the four sides of the square. High - quality square tube machines have extremely accurate roller alignments and pressure control mechanisms. This precision is crucial as it determines the straightness and uniformity of the square tubes.
In terms of technology, modern square tube machines are equipped with automated control panels. These panels enable operators to set parameters such as the speed of production, the dimensions of the square tubes, and the type of metal being processed. Additionally, there are sensors installed within the machine. These sensors monitor the production process in real - time, detecting any potential issues such as metal fatigue or misalignment of the shaping components.
The applications of square tubes produced by these machines are extensive. They are widely used in construction for structural support, in the automotive industry for frames, and in the furniture sector for creating sturdy and stylish designs. The square tube machine has thus become an indispensable asset in meeting the diverse demands of various industries.
